180 megs? sheesh, some of us only have 256meg capacity on our non-iPod video players…any way to shrink that? (yes, okay, technically 256 megs is enough for 180 megs on its own, but *all* the podcasts i load at any given time have to fit in that…)
Rich - I’ll see what I can do. It’s a long show at 50 mins and the resolution’s pretty low already. The encoding can be tweaked a bit but 50 mins of video is going to be in the 70-100 MB mark however you cut it.
Let me see if I can do something clever over the next few days.

If you have access to a Mac, Mpeg Streamclip 1.5.1 probably does the best and smallest iPod encodes for video. You could probably dramatically reduce the size of the clip without losing video quality. Just bring in the original video, click ‘export mp4′ and then click the iPod button.
Wiley - thanks for the tip.
I’ve got a copy of Streamclip. The reason these shows are heavy because I was trying to preserve quality overall (i.e, high-quality stereo audio). This time around I’ve traded some quality for size and used a format which makes better quality files easily available to people who want them too.
The ’small’ file this week is 40mins and only 80MB and the biggest file is still sub 200MB.
